OBIT: VIRGINIA BUTLER

Virginia Butler, affectionately known as “Mother Butler,” passed away on July 12, 2025, in Mesquite, Texas, at the age of 85. Born on November 19, 1939, in Neches, Texas, Virginia was a cherished matriarch who touched the lives of many with her kindness, wisdom, and unwavering support.

Virginia’s journey began in the small town of Neches, where she was raised with strong values and a deep sense of community. Her maiden name, Diles, reflects her roots and the legacy of love and resilience instilled in her from an early age. Throughout her life, she carried these values forward, becoming a vital presence in the lives of those around.

Virginia was known for her nurturing spirit and her ability to inspire those she loved. Her warmth and generosity extended beyond her family, as she built lasting friendships in every community she was part of. Virginia’s home was a place of comfort and joy, filled with laughter and shared memories.

Virginia Butler leaves behind a legacy of devotion and strength that will be felt for generations to come. Her gentle soul and caring nature will be sorely missed by all who had the privilege of knowing her. As we remember “Mother Butler,” let us carry her spirit of kindness and love in our hearts.
